Aaron Northcraft
Born: 5/28/1990 in Tucson, AZ, USA
MLB Debut: 2021-04-24 | Final Game: 2021-05-29
Bats: R | Throws: R | Height: 6'3" | Weight: 229 lbs
Full name: Aaron Lee Northcraft
Biography
Aaron Northcraft, born in 1990, was a professional baseball pitcher whose career spanned from April 24, 2021, to May 29, 2021. He made a brief yet impactful mark in Major League Baseball during his short tenure, showcasing his skills primarily as a right-handed pitcher. Northcraft finished his career with a record of 1-0 and an impressive earned run average (ERA) of 2.25, demonstrating his ability to perform effectively on the mound despite limited opportunities.
During his time in the league, Northcraft recorded a total of 5 strikeouts, highlighting his capacity to challenge hitters and contribute to his team's pitching efforts.
